Psych RN, Care Manager
Centene Corporation. Provide case management and service coordination to members living with mental illness and/or substance abuse disorders.
Posted 4/21/2026full-timeDallas • Texas • 🇺🇸 United StatesJuniorMid-Level💰 $36 - $65 per hourWebsite
About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Provide case management and service coordination to members living with mental illness and/or substance abuse disorders.
- Develops, assesses and coordinates holistic care management activities.
- Evaluates member service needs and develops or contributes to development of care plans/service plans.
- Acts as liaison and member advocate between the member/family, physician, and facilities/agencies.
- Supports members with primarily mental/behavioral health needs.
- Performs frequent home and/or other site visits to assess member needs and collaborate with resources.
- Educates on and coordinates community resources.
- Maintains accurate documentation and supports the integrity of care management activities.
Requirements
What you’ll need- Graduate from an Accredited School of Nursing and 2 – 4 years of related behavioral health/psychiatric experience.
- RN - Registered Nurse - State Licensure and/or Compact State Licensure required or NP - Nurse Practitioner - Current State's Nurse Licensure required
- Clinical RN with 3+ years of psychological admissions/intakes.
- 3+ years of clinical RN experience supporting members with primarily mental/behavioral health needs.
- Direct work experience coordinating and managing healthcare/behavioral health services and personal assistance/social services.
- Experience in FIELD-BASED roles or work in-patient behavioral health hospital, community health, home health, outpatient mental health, substance abuse/ detox recovery treatment, or state social services settings (MHAs, LIDDA).
- Current or previous government-sponsored healthcare experience preferred.
- Critical thinking skills and ability to use nursing judgement to assess member’s health risks to ensure member safety.
- Strong clinical documentation and time management skills.
- Flexibility, resilience, and excellent interpersonal communication skills for member advocacy.
- Reliable transportation is required.
